Article: Sydney Devine in intensive care following heart surgery; Show goes on: Devine plans to sing next month.

Byline: Maureen Culley

VETERAN country singer Sydney Devine was in intensive care in a Spanishhospital last night following heart surgery.

The Scots star had been staying at his holiday home near Malaga on the Costadel Sol when he complained of stomach pains.

Surgeons operated after finding the 67-year-old had two aneurisms in his aorta,the main artery that takes blood from the heart.

A spokesman for the Xanit Hospital Internacional in the Andalucian town ofBenalmadena said the surgery had gone well and the star was 'stable' inintensive care.
